WebAround here you can buy plain noodles, I just checked and online supermarket, doesn't list sodium content but does list "salt", one brand is labeled "Ramen noodles" and contains 1,5g salt per 100 g. Another brand lists 0,55g of salt per 100g and a third brand just 0,08g of salt per 100g! So it looks like it varies a lot! WebNov 21, 2024 · On the other hand, for the thick ramen noodles, cooking time is longer, and the hardness tends to be too much, so use flour with low protein content and balance the hardness with high sodium carbonate ratio.
